Scientists track eye changes in diabetes to speed up new treatments

NCT ID NCT07270133

First seen Jan 11, 2026 · Last updated May 24, 2026 · Updated 23 times

Summary

This study aims to better understand how the retina (the light-sensitive part of the eye) changes in people with diabetes. Researchers will use various eye tests, like vision checks and special scans, to see how these changes relate to the severity of diabetic eye disease. The goal is to find better ways to measure eye health in future treatment trials. About 450 adults with diabetes and some without will take part.
